To the late Rev. J. B. Reade is incontestably due the honour of having
first applied tannin as an accelerator, and hyposulphite of soda as a
fixing agent, to the production and retention of light-produced
pictures; and having first obtained an ineffaceable photograph upon
paper. Mr. Talbot's gallate of silver process was not patented or
published till 1841; whereas the Rev. J. B. Reade produced paper
negatives by means of gallic acid and nitrate of silver in 1837. It will
be remembered that Mr. Wedgwood had discovered and stated that the
chloride of silver was more sensitive when applied to white leather, and
Mr. Reade, by inductive reasoning, came to the conclusion that tanned
paper and silver would be more sensitive to light than ordinary paper
coated with nitrate of silver could possibly be. As the reverend
philosopher's ideas on that subject are probably the first that ever
impregnated the mind of man, and as his experiments and observations are
the very earliest in the pursuit of a gallic acid accelerator and
developer, I will give them in his own words.--"No one can dispute my
claim to be the first to suggest the use of gallic acid as a sensitiser
for prepared paper, and hyposulphite of soda as a fixer. These are the
keystones of the arch at which Davy and Young had laboured--or, as I may
say in the language of another science, we may vary the tones as we
please, but here is the fundamental base. My use of gallate of silver
was the result of an inference from Wedgwood's experiments with leather,
'which is more readily acted upon than paper' (_Journal of the Royal
Institution_, vol. i., p. 171). Mrs. Reade was so good as to give me a
pair of light-coloured leather gloves, that I might repeat Wedgwood's
experiment, and, as my friend Mr. Ackerman reminds me, her little
objection to let me have a second pair led me to say, 'Then I will tan
paper.' Accordingly I used an infusion of galls in the first instance in
the early part of the year 1837, when I was engaged in taking
photographs of microscopic objects. By a new arrangement of lenses in
the solar microscope, I produced a convergence of the rays of light,
while the rays of heat, owing to their different refractions, were
parallel or divergent. This fortunate dispersion of the calorific rays
enabled me to use objects mounted in balsam, as well as cemented
achromatic object glasses; and, indeed, such was the coolness of the
illumination, that even _infusoria_ in single drops of water were
perfectly happy and playful (_vide_ abstracts of the 'Philosophical
Transactions,' December 22nd, 1836). The continued expense of an
artist--though, at first, I employed my friend, Lens Aldons--to copy the
pictures on the screen was out of the question. I therefore fell back,
but without any sanguine expectations as to the result, upon the
photographic process adopted by Wedgwood, with which I happened to be
